2025 AFCON: Two countries qualify for tournament

Burkina Faso have confirmed their place at the 2025 Africa Cup of Nations.

This follows their 2-0 victory over Burundi on Sunday in a qualifying fixture.

Bertrand Traore and Mohamed Konate scored the goals for the Stallions in Abidjan.

They qualified after a draw with Senegal, a win over Malawi and two victories against Burundi.

It will be the 14th AFCON appearance for the Burkina Babes, whose best outing was finishing runners-up behind Nigeria in South Africa 11 years ago.

Senegal will join Burkina Faso in Morocco next year if they win in Malawi on Tuesday.

Burkina Faso have 10 points, Senegal seven, Burundi three and Malawi none.

Morocco, an automatic participant at the next AFCON as the host nation, is playing the qualifiers for competitive match practice.
